1․1 Overview of the Graphic Novel

Drama, a New York Times bestselling graphic novel by Raina Telgemeier, follows Callie, a middle school student passionate about theater․ As part of the stage crew, she aspires to create a Broadway-worthy set for her school’s production of Moon Over Mississippi․ The story explores her determination, challenges, and growth amidst budget constraints, crew conflicts, and middle school struggles․ With colorful, vibrant illustrations by Gurihiru, the novel captures the excitement of theater and the complexities of adolescence․ Available in PDF format, Drama is a heartwarming and engaging read, blending humor and relatable experiences for young readers․

4․3 The Impact of Two Brothers

The arrival of two brothers, Justin and Jesse, shakes up the dynamics of the drama club, introducing romantic tensions and personal conflicts․ Their presence not only complicates Callie’s relationships but also influences the group’s collaboration and focus on the play․ The brothers’ differing personalities and interests create a magnetic yet challenging environment, pushing Callie to navigate her feelings and priorities․ Their impact extends beyond romance, as they also influence the team’s creativity and unity, making them pivotal characters in Callie’s journey of self-discovery and growth during the production of Moon Over Mississippi․
